Penshurst Station is straightforward in its offerings, providing essential services for those embarking on a journey. While there isn't a ticket office, travelers can still collect tickets purchased online via accessible ticket machines. The station features an induction loop for the hearing impaired and support for travelers with disabilities is available through help points.
Accessibility is a mixed bag at Penshurst. While some facilities are step-free, certain areas of the station aren't. Specifically, there is step-free access to both platforms via separate entrances, but there is no step-free transition between platforms. Assistance can be pre-arranged, or accessed by using on-board train staff when available. The station lacks wa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shment facilities, which travelers should keep in mind when planning their visit.

Shirehampton train station is a minimalist stop in terms of amenities, focusing on straightforward accessibility. There isn't a ticket office or machine, so travelers need to buy and retrieve tickets by alternative means such as online booking. Despite the absence of physical ticketing infrastructure, the station does feature departure screens and a help point for any immediate travel inquiries.
Accessibility is a key feature, with step-free access throughout the station, ensuring a seamless experience for those with reduced mobility. However, travelers should note the lack of waiting rooms, restrooms, and refreshment facilities on the premises. Still, the station extends a warm welcome with available seating areas and customer help points to assist passengers.
When it comes to connectivity, Shirehampton station integrates multiple modes of transport to ease your onward journey. While taxi services aren't available directly at the station, travelers can find taxis on the station approach road. The nearby bus laybys on A4 Portway by the footbridge serve as pivotal spots for rail replacement services, should the need arise. For cyclists, bike storage facilities are conveniently located at the station entrance and on the platform, although there is no covered or secured area.
